Responsibilities
Key Responsibilities
Develop energy projects from site identification / land acquisition through to permitting (e.g. environmental / building permit laws) and - depending on project - support through to commissioning.
Assess potential project sites and create optimised layouts for wind turbines, solar PV arrays, or battery storage facilities.
Prepare and manage permit applications under relevant legislation, coordinate with regulatory authorities.
Commission and manage third-party consultants (e.g. environmental / soil / planning consultants) and collaborate with external planners / construction contractors.
Develop project schedules and budgets; monitor costs and manage contractual documents (public- and private-law contracts).
Liaise with stakeholders including government/regulatory bodies, private landowners, community representatives, and project partners.
Ensure project compliance with legal, environmental, and planning standards, and manage documentation throughout project lifecycle.
